Output 53bcaca22bd5671e34d7e01b9d08695137fa03d39dbc266f23e7cd5e8926ed6a:20

value
22043601
script pubkey
OP_0 OP_PUSHBYTES_20 c758f66cfe8ef817c056db161a603ab2b836e4e4
address
ltc1qcav0vm873mup0szkmvtp5cp6k2urde8ymn5qdy
transaction
53bcaca22bd5671e34d7e01b9d08695137fa03d39dbc266f23e7cd5e8926ed6a
spent
true